The Great Multitude

Ron Hamilton, Conference Minister

Excitement is growing as we approach the time for the 2024 annual gathering that will be held in Rhode Island from July 31 – August 2.  The theme for the gathering is “The Great Multitude”.  This theme is based on the great teaching of Revelation 7:9-10.

“After this I looked, and there before me was a great multitude that no one could count, from every nation, tribe, people, and language, standing before the throne and before the Lamb. They were wearing white robes and were holding palm branches in their hands.  And they cried out in a loud voice:

“Salvation belongs to our God,

who sits on the throne,

and to the Lamb.” 

Heavenly worship is Christ-centered, celebrating salvation that is available to all who believe and join the family of faith.  The Scripture is clear.  This family is large and diverse.  It includes people from every nation, tribe, people, and language.

Fifty years ago, Coca-Cola shared a commercial that included the words, “I’d Like to Teach the World to Sing (In Perfect Harmony).”  We all know that Coke couldn’t do it.  No politician or ideology can do it.  No hero or star can do it.  But Jesus can!  The great multitude in heaven is, and will eternally be, a large and diverse group of people worshipping our Lord and Savior, Jesus Christ.

One of the Guiding Values of the CCCC is, “A Membership Reflective of the Harvest Field’s Diversity.”  We have a unique opportunity to build a large and diverse family of believers in this generation.  The world has come to our doorstep.  Our mission field includes people from different nations, tribes, people groups, and languages.

One of my favorite memories of an annual gathering was when we formed a conga line to dance to the music of the choir from our church in Portland, Maine.  These African immigrants encouraged us to worship the Lord in any way that we found appropriate.  The spirit of celebration was exciting and passionate.  We trust that this will be the spirit of our annual gathering this summer.

We are privileged to have Mathew John as our main plenary speaker this summer.  Mathew is the Senior Pastor of the Lake Avenue Church in Pasadena, California.  This church is developing a new generation of ministry in one of the most diverse cities in our nation.  Mathew is uniquely gifted to speak to us on our subject and has prepared messages that will inspire us to serve the Lord in this generation.
